Accessible Entry: Understanding Physical Inclines

A carefully built accessibility ramp is a crucial element for providing inclusive entry to buildings and spaces for individuals with mobility challenges. Such structures typically feature a gradual incline that allows safe and independent movement for wheelchair users . Adherence to municipal building codes is critical to maintain the functionality and practicality of the ramp, relating to required rise and length . Consideration must also be given to grab rails and a non-slip surface for increased stability.

Wheelchair Ramps: A Guide to Options and Installation

Providing usable access for people with mobility impairments is crucial , and wheelchair ramps offer a practical solution. There's a wide variety of ramp kinds available, each designed for different situations. These include transportable ramps, which are ideal for occasional use and can be conveniently stored when not in use; fixed ramps, often built of wood and attached directly to a structure ; and sectional ramps, offering a flexible system for difficult landscapes. Proper setup is positively important for stability. Think about local building codes and ordinances before starting any project. Professional help from a certified contractor is usually recommended , especially for challenging installations. Ultimately , a well-designed and adequately installed wheelchair ramp greatly enhances self-sufficiency and level of life .

Choosing the Right Disability Ramp for Your Needs

Selecting the perfect accessibility platform for people with limitations requires detailed evaluation. Factor in the surface – is it flat or angled? Determine the required rise and length to guarantee comfortable entry . In addition, review the various styles of ramps accessible, including movable ramps, sectional ramps, and permanent ramps, to find the most option for your unique situation . Ultimately, keep in mind local accessibility standards for compliance .
